WebApr 14, 2024 · Take the length measurement in the back, from collar to hem. Flip the shirt over and smooth out any wrinkles. Place the measuring tape at the bottom edge of the collar, right where it connects to the shirt. Pull the measuring tape straight down towards the bottom edge of the hem, and record your measurement.

WebThe numeric cuff size (ie, width in centimeters) should be 40% of the circumference of the cuff site in dogs and 30% to 40% of the circumference of the cuff site in cats. Measure the site using a centimeter-marked tape (A) or estimate using the cuff itself (B). A cuff that is too small or tight results in falsely elevated readings, and a cuff ... As a general rule, the cuff size is around 1 to 1.5 inches (2.5 to 3.8 centimeters) larger than your wrist measurement. This will ensure a comfortable fit and enough room for movement. For a more relaxed fit, you can add an extra half-inch (1.25 centimeters) to the measurement. irs and 2022 taxesWebJul 12, 2024 · Manual BP measurement using a cuff is performed in two ways.
